Any Amazon Employees or Reps on OzBargain

Amazon closed my account on the basis that they were unable to verify my debit card payment method.

I explained to them that debit cards do not generate statements. I sent them a bank statement with my details also showing the last 4 digits of the debit card from a recent purchase via the card.
This is how its reflected on bank statement

They then emailed me and said based on the information provided , they closed my account . Lol WTF.

I also had $245 gift card balance

Would appreciate if any amazon employee is on ozbargain that can help with this matter.

    I live in Austria and made a purchase on Amazon.de with a debit card. Five minutes after that I received a mail that my account is on hold due to suspicious activity detected on it. Documents that I submitted were not enough initially. I used the guidance from the top post here and after re-sending my data two times, I was contacted back by '[email protected]'. Additionally to everything (passport selfie, debit card selfie and online banking screenshots) they required a Utility bill as well. After sending my utility bill (name, address and phone visible on it), my account was unlocked. Thanks to the author

    I think part of the reason they closed it is because your proof (bank statement) is a year old and shows you had a balance of $10.
    How would you pay $2000 for phones if your balance was $10? Your proof basically tells them you are a scammer or have stolen the card and old statement details or the payment will somehow get reversed by the bank as a chargeback etc.
    Can you not provide them with a more up to date statement (even if it means going to woolworths and spending $1 now so you can show them the last four digits of your card and a screenshot of that transaction and your balance today where you can afford the phones).
